The Firehouse Restaurant is a renowned fine dining establishment located in historic Old Sacramento, California. Established in 1960, it occupies a beautifully restored 1853 redbrick firehouse, which originally served as the home for Engine Company No. 3 of Sacramento's first fire department. The restaurant was transformed from a small bar into a dining venue by Newton Cope and his partners after significant renovations.
